Subject: Sweeper cut-over done

Hey — quick wrap-up. The Tidewipe retention sweeper switched to the new scheduler tonight and the first pass completed clean, no orphaned batches. Alerts now route through the standard pager channel, so old silences won't apply. If it pages, check batch lag first. It's now running with these config values.

config for kagup-hahig:
druwyn:
  pin: 2801
  metrics_host: metrics.druwyn.zemvarlabs.internal
  tenant: sorius
  seal: seal_798a43d7

**Vendor note: Inkmill markdown pipeline**

Rendering for Parchway docs is outsourced to Inkmill under an annual contract, renewing each March. They handle sanitization and PDF export; we own the upload queue. SLA: 4-hour response on rendering failures. Escalate only after two failed retries. Their support desk is reachable at the address below.

billing contact of hahaf-baguf = zorael.tammir.jorius@sivrelhq.internal

TICKET — Missed Pick-up

The scheduled collection of four nitrate-era film reels from the Orvessa Screening Annex did not occur this morning; the Calderwick Archive's registrar waited until 10:40 with no courier arrival. The reels remain in their climate cases in the annex cold room and must move today, as the archive's intake window closes at 17:00. Please reassign to the next available vetted driver and confirm the revised slot with the registrar. The confidential hand-over instruction for the replacement courier is set out directly below.

dispatch memo: the quenvan holax courier leaves the zoreth briath kasvan ledger at gate 7481 under passcode 618862

Release checklist — Lintbarrel baseline: yes, we regenerated the static-analysis baseline file again. Before you wave this through, diff it against last release's; about 40 findings were suppressed and most are in the Cobbleway payments module, so worth a skim for anything that smells like a real injection issue getting buried. Baseline checksum is committed alongside. Match your review notes to the build token below.

build token for kagaf-hahof: htk14_9d3d4d26d7d8de